Learn a Chinese Character - 牺 (xī) - Sacrifice

Chinese Character: (xī - Sacrifice)

1. Character Basics (基本特征)

Radical:(cow radical)

Stroke Count: 10 (10 strokes)

Character Decomposition: 牛 + 西 (cow + west)

3. Meaning (含义)

牺 primarily means sacrifice, and is used in various contexts related to offering and devotion.

7. Example Sentence (例句)

他为了国家牺牲了自己。(Tā wèi le guó jiā xī shēng le zì jǐ.)
He sacrificed himself for the country.
